Transaction 5b51e0809668885283667f96590b18406c453d2cfd32486604a9838c75ecfc23

1 Input
2 Outputs
  • 5b51e0809668885283667f96590b18406c453d2cfd32486604a9838c75ecfc23:0
  • value  165522
    address  126pFD6MeGK8UngPydUi86EGYoKh3qwXrc
  • 5b51e0809668885283667f96590b18406c453d2cfd32486604a9838c75ecfc23:1
  • value  662
    address  bc1qc7y6n96kp2agyndv3833dmy5khdcnspe6xrfpa